From maximizing the existing footprint in retrofits to reducing the spread of infection and supporting the flex needs of the hybrid workspace, this course will cover how interior sliding doors serve as versatile solutions meeting on-the-rise design trends while addressing ongoing space-efficiency and sound attenuation needs. Learn how interior sliding doors can help optimize occupant comfort through the use of daylighting and enhanced acoustic performance. Then, find out how to mitigate the spread of infection through sliding doors systems with touchless technology. Additionally, explore how space saving efficiencies can improve useability, address occupant accessibility challenges and facilitate healthy movement.
